Transaction 0500df708dd59f19f34f8eae1be40524c63649586ebf8720e2af0f7645c319aa

1 Input
2 Outputs
  • 0500df708dd59f19f34f8eae1be40524c63649586ebf8720e2af0f7645c319aa:0
  • value  34980495
    address  33v59zZEQqDZUFUWKr9eujTrwdn3fhBqGC
  • 0500df708dd59f19f34f8eae1be40524c63649586ebf8720e2af0f7645c319aa:1
  • value  41807966
    address  3PDb8MaW3uDHsarxjhzNPoYHNZQUrZq8Xb